Amping up Delight – How to Actually Maximize Customer Pleasure
In my last newsletter, I highlighted twelve forms of pleasure outlined by Professors Costello and Edmonds. Those dimensions are creation, exploration, discovery, difficulty, competition, danger, captivation, sensation, sympathy, fantasy, camaraderie, and subversion.
